Output Commit 09c40b95e223219c999ed6be154a5679ef215881427556ce002e666302306ea23d



Created at block 460835 (Confirmed count: 79079)

Created At 2019-12-03 08:25:52
Output Type Transaction
Proof -
Proof hash 130a8d63a2c4363d0748560a56ac2476ee1ba4498be4e58b6ac0cfb629c463c5
Merkle Proof -
MMR Index 4922546